Samoa Joe discusses his move to the WWE Raw roster

WWE wrestler Samoa Joe spoke with Brian Fritz and Michael Wiseman of BetweenTheRopes.com and was asked whether he had a timeline for being on the WWE main roster. “I think my timeline was more along, I wanted things to be right. Timing is everything like anything line life… I wanted the table to be set and I wanted us to go forward with the plan and kind of a direction. When it was the right time it was the right time. I felt the time was right and it’s gone really well.

“And also, I was committed to helping NXT grow as a brand, to make it become more than it is. It was a process, but I think we accomplished a lot of that and the natural move to Raw or Smackdown was in the cards and I’m on Raw now.” Watch the interview at Youtube.com.

Powell’s POV: Joe also spoke about Seth Rollins getting hurt when he debuted on Raw, whether he had a brand preference when he was called up, and which wrestlers he would like to face on Smackdown.
